Information about depth that relies on just one eye, includes relative size , light and shadow, interposition, relative motion, and atmospheric perspective. Depth perception means perception of distances from object from each other or from observer.

As in one eyed individuals, depth perception is limited, not entirely absent, hence, they would still be able to drive a car or land an airplane.
